Roger Redmon

Roger Neal Redmon, 73, of Chrisman, Illinois, passed away at 8:45 a.m. Saturday, October 15, 2022, at his residence.
He was born October 13, 1949, in Paris, Illinois, the son of the late Francis and Virginia (Malone) Redmon. He married Angela D. Ross on April 4, 2016, in Chrisman, Illinois.
Survivors include his wife and loving companion of over twenty-one years, Angie Redmon; seven children, Angela Donovan of Paris, Josh (Nicole) Redmon of Bonnie Lake, Washington, Jason Redmon of Seymour, Indiana, Sarah Redmon of Paris, Austin Redmon of Paris, Levi Potter of Chrisman, and Kelsey Potter (Blake Bristow) of Chrisman; three brothers, John Redmon of Ocoee, Florida, Rodney Redmon of Paris, and Robert Redmon of Paris; two sisters, Elizabeth Davis of Paris and Donna Dorn of Westville, Illinois; ten grandchildren, including Zayden Potter whom he raised and with whom he shared a special bond; four great-grandchildren; his parents-in-law, Ron and Barbara Ross of Chrisman, Illinois; and several nieces and nephews. He was preceded in death by a son, Ryan Redmon, and an infant great-granddaughter.
Mr. Redmon was a member of the Wabash Valley Musicians Hall of Fame.
Roger will be remembered as a free spirit who loved motorcycling and spending time with his family. Aside from his family, nothing made him happier than enjoying music and sharing it with others, or as he liked to put it, “set the music free.” He was a talented guitarist who enjoyed playing daily his entire life. He played in a number of bands through the years, most notably TKO and Sister Tess.
